Be aware of what to do if you receive a suspicious phone call.
On March 9, 2026, the Downers Grove Police Department responded to a report of a possible phone scam. The victim received a phone call from a person identifying themself as a Downers Grove police officer, requesting payment of several thousand dollars in order to resolve a so-called legal matter. Luckily, before making the payment, the victim walked into the Downers Grove Police Department to verify.
Residents are reminded of the following:
- The Downers Grove Police Department will never call you to demand money or payment over the phone.
- The Downers Grove Police Department will never ask for payment to avoid arrest.
- If you receive a suspicious call, DO NOT provide any personal or financial information and HANG UP.
- Report the suspicious phone call to 9-1-1 or the Downers Grove Police Department at 630-434-5600.
